Future research projects:
(1) Organizational behavior and management: here I will continue to study organizational politics, organizational citizenship behavior, innovation and change, as well as employees behavior in public sector organizations, and will try to relate these issues with performance and affectivity of modern bureaucracies based on multiple sources of data and a comparative view of the private sector and the public sector;
(2) Public administration, public management, and politics: here I intend to focus on citizens' role in governance, collaboration among the three sectors (private, public, and third sector), on citizens attitudes towards governments and their relationship with democratic mechanisms both in the federal, state, and the local level. In this area I intend to examine the behaviors of both citizens and public personnel under dynamics of change and reforms in the public sector.
